A) Communication No. 23-05, received on July 10, 2023, from Appellant appealing
a classification or reclassification of a particular position action (denial of a
reallocation request from an Engineering Support Technician III to an
Engineering Support Technician IV) by the Hawaii County Human Resources
Department (Note: At its meeting held on July 28, 2023, with both parties
present, the Board scheduled a hearing date); and
Communication No. 23-05.01, received on September 5, 2023, from Appellant
rescinding the appeal and to cancel the scheduled hearing.
B) Communication No. 23-06, dated July 25, 2023, from Salary Commission Chair,
Steven Pavao, requesting the Merit Appeals Board's participation in providing
information to determine whether future salary adjustments (increase, decrease, or
status quo) be incorporated into the fiscal year 2023-2024 for the Director of
Human Resources (Note: At its meeting held on August 30, 2023, the Board
authorized Acting Director of Human Resources, Danny B. Patel, to respond to
the Salary Commission's inquiry on their behalf); and
Communication No. 23-06.01, dated September 6, 2023, from Acting Director of
Human Resources, Danny B. Patel, to Salary Commission Chair Steven Pavao
and members, responding to their inquiry concerning future salary adjustments.

If you are a lobbyist, you must register with the Hawaii County Clerk within five
days of becoming a lobbyist [Article 15, Section 2-91.3(b), Hawaii County Code]. A
lobbyist means "any individual engaged for pay or other consideration who spends
more than five hours in any month or $275 in any six-month period for the purpose of
attempting to influence legislative or administrative action by communicating or
urging others to communicate with public officials." [Article 15, Section 2-91.3
(a)(6), Hawai`i County Code]. Registration forms and expenditure report documents
are available at the Office of the County Clerk -Council, 25 Aupuni Street, Hilo,
Hawaii 96720.
